Senate Committee Discusses Progress and Theft of Assets at Pakistan Steel Mills

A meeting of the Senate Standing Committee on Industries and Production was held under the chairmanship of Senator Khalida Ateeb in Islamabad today. The committee members engaged in discussions regarding the progress made in the maintenance of Pakistan Steel Mills (PSM) and the alarming issue of theft involving the company’s assets, allegedly valued at billions of rupees.

Stolen Gas Valve and Dismissal of Officer Spark Controversy

During the meeting, Senator Fida Muhammad brought attention to the theft of a gas valve worth millions of rupees from PSM. Chairperson Khalida Ateeb highlighted that an officer involved in the theft of goods worth Rs. 10 billion had been dismissed by Pakistan Steel Mills. Expressing her opinion, she suggested that the individual be reinstated and questioned the whereabouts of the stolen goods.

Briefing on Theft Case and Payment of Pending Dues

PSM officials provided a briefing to the committee, revealing that the case related to the theft is currently under investigation by the Federal Investigation Agency (FIA). They clarified that Engineer Abdur Rehman Warraich was held responsible for the stolen equipment, which was valued at Rs. 4.7 million. Following an inquiry, the steel mills authorities found him guilty of theft and misconduct.

The committee also received a briefing on the status of pending dues payments to PSM employees. The Additional Secretary Industries informed the members that outstanding dues amounting to Rs. 12 billion had been fully paid to 4,734 out of a total of 5,282 PSM employees. However, payments totaling Rs. 1.66 billion to 1,591 individuals are still pending, with 42 employees resorting to legal action.
